Royals prove mightier than Pirates

San Marcos’ girls tennis team claimed 7-of-9 sets in both singles and doubles on Wednesday, more than enough for the victory in a 14-4 decision over Santa Ynez at Alisal Country Club.

Amy Ransohoff and Christine Pearson led the way doubles, pairing up to sweep their sets for the second time this season.

“Amy and Christine were all over the court, hitting volley winners and backing each other up after poaches. It was fun to see them play so hard and so together,” said Royals coach Jarrod Bradley.

Parisa Fallihi and Liz Morris can also say they swept three sets, as did No. 1 singles player Caitlin Mannix. In the match of the day, Chloe Maassen shook off two set points to come back and win her second set.

Emily Ineman posted a winning day for Santa Ynez, winning two-of-three sets.

San Marcos improves its record to 3-2 a day before a key Channel League clash with Santa Barbara on Thursday.
